The accompanying data was obtained in a study to evaluate the liquefaction potential at a proposed nuclear power station (“Cyclic Strengths Compared for Two Sampling Techniques,” J. of the Geotechnical Division, Am. Soc. Civil Engrs. Proceedings, 1981: 563–576). Before cyclic strength testing, soil samples were gathered using both a pitcher tube method and ablock method, resulting in the following observed values of dry density (lb/ft3):

Calculate and interpret a 95% CI for the difference between true average dry densities for the two sampling methods.
